Hi all, I was just switching from an older version of ROOT (3.00/06) to the newest 3.03/09 and noticed that the color scale on COLZ plots is different: Less than the 50 colors of the gSystem->SetPalette(1) default are used. I found the reason for this change to be the introduction of contour levels. My histograms do not have contour levels set, so the default of 20 levels. I know you can change in the TH* itself, but this is very inconvenient for e.g. tree->Draw("...") or TBrowser draw selections as a new histogram is created each time.
